Monterey Vs. California Human Services Employment
| Monterey | 460 |
| California | 91,780 |
Exactly 460 of the 91,780 human services professionals employed in California, work in Monterey. The number of human services professionals in Monterey has shrunk by 15% from 2006 to 2010. Overall employment in Monterey has also decreased.

In Monterey, salaries for human services professionals have increased. Monterey human services professionals made $50,030 per year, on average, in 2010. The average salary for human services professionals in Monterey was $47,920 per year, four years earlier in 2006. The growth in the salary of human services professionals in Monterey is slower than the salary trend for all careers in the city.

Human services professionals in Monterey make a median yearly salary of $45,660. The 10% of human services professionals in the lowest pay bracket earn less than $28,700 per year, while those in the highest pay bracket earn approximately $79,268 per year.
